Some Fort Worth parents are addressing a school safety gap using privately funded security.

So far, the nonprofit has handpicked nearly 10 off-duty Fort Worth Police Officers.

"The relationship building and community is the most important along with safety. Safety is paramount," Carter said. "As TAVS develops this program and they get officers working in these schools, what kind of training is available to make sure that we have the right officers in those schools," Wheeler said."Whether it be emotional intelligence, conflict resolution, leadership development, our department has all kinds of training."
